Trip Overview

The drive from Surfside Beach, SC to Sumter, SC covers 107.8 miles and takes about 2h 18m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.

The route leans on US Highway 521, Ocean Highway, North Brooks Street for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is mixed dr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 26.8 miles on US Highway 521. At current regular gas prices, budget about $16.86 one way before food or hotel costs.

How Hard Is This Drive?

This route mixes highway mileage with some local-road sections near the start or finish. There are only a few real navigation decisions along the way. The trickiest moment comes around 27.4 miles in near US 17 Alternate; US 521 / Highmarket Street.

Route Complexity 3/10

Easy - simple navigation with a manageable amount of wheel time

This is a straightforward 2h 18m drive. You will face about 5 decision points, but nothing that requires special attention if you follow navigation.

Where does it get tricky?

The main spots that need attention: at 27.4 miles (US 17 Alternate; US 521 / Highmarket Street): Merge point - match speed before joining; at 86.1 miles: Highway fork - watch signs carefully; at 86.3 miles (US 521; SC 261 / Greeleyville Highway): Merge point - match speed before joining.
